_HttpRequest_Test

HTTP Requests

_HttpRequest_Test

Top  Previous  Next

 

Ghi giá trị trả về của _HttpRequest ra một tập tin

 

_HttpRequest_Test($sData [, $FilePath = Default, $iEncoding = Default, $iShellexecute = True ])

 

 

 

* Tham số

$sData

Dữ liệu cần ghi

$FilePath

Đường dẫn + tên tập tin cần ghi. Mặc định: ghi file HTML nằm cùng đường dẫn script AutoIt

$iEncoding

Dạng mã hoá của tập tin. Xem thêm phần Ghi chú.

$iShellexecute

Chạy tập tin sau khi đã ghi hay không ? Mặc định: Có

 

 

 

* Ghi chú

$iEncoding ở chế độ mặc định sẽ chọn tự động Unicode (UTF-8 without BOM) nếu $sData là String hoặc Binary nếu$sData là dữ liệu Binary.

 

Bảng thông số Encoding (xem thêm FileOpen)

Value

Encoding

16

Binary

32

Unicode UTF16 Little Endian

64

Unicode UTF16 Big Endian

128

Unicode UTF8 (with BOM)

256

Unicode UTF8 (without BOM)

512

Unicode UTF16 Little Endian (without BOM)

1024

Unicode UTF16 Big Endian (without BOM)

2048

Unicode UTF16 Big Endian (without BOM)

 

Khi request để tải về một tập tin (ảnh, tài liệu, file zip, rar...) thì $iReturn phải là 3 hoặc 5 hoặc - 2 hoặc - 4

 

 

 

* Ví dụ

#include <_HttpRequest.au3>

$rq = _HttpRequest(2, 'http://mp3.zing.vn/')                                                                                                    

_HttpRequest_Test($rq)

 

#include <_HttpRequest.au3>

$rq = _HttpRequest(3, http://static.mp3.zdn.vn/skins/zmp3-v4.2/images/logo.png') ; Tải ảnh logo.png

_HttpRequest_Test($rq)